      compared to LG CX I think this monitor will actually disappoint very fast in the fact that colors will shift or burn in fast by being pure RGB oled...
      While LG CX uses blue+white oled and color filter for the colors, with pure RGB oled if used at high brightness it only need a few amount of hours for the blue to start loosing intensity and then the screen shifts color as the blue looses intensity or burn-in...
      In theory for example showing just a white screen the LG CX would get dimmer with time but would always look white and this monitor would start to not look white.
      ps: But sure for now nothing beats a pure RGB OLED display and will have more color than LG OLED TV. Only microled beats it but for now they are all fake and the actual microleds displays that exist which are actually super incredible are super little for AR\VR\projectors like JBD shown a few years ago 1 million nits tiny super high 5000 ppi true microled displays but they are done in silicon wafers like a CPU\GPU so their method of making them sadly wouldn't be good for a monitor size :(

    • @guily6669
      @guily6669 3 года назад

      @@pepperjobs8591 AMOLED sub pixels are true Red, Green and Blue all oled subpixels and all those different colors have very different lifespans being blue the one to die way faster than the other 2...
      LG OLED TV uses blue+yellow OLED panel and to make the colors they use a color filter in front, so it will never look as good as RGB OLED but it's probably a more controllable and more longer lasting when all the pixels are the same, the color will never shift that much as for example the white will remain white even if it loses a slight amount of brightness it will just look slightly burned-in (though to the loss of brightness) but still will look white.
      A RGB oled as soon as the parts mostly using blue sub pixel constantly will make the screen shift colors faster as the blue loses brightness against the green and the red everything will keep looking different, the white will not look white anymore, instead will be a burn-in in a very different color sooner than LG solution.
